  1. Purchase a license: The most straightforward way to remove the watermark is to purchase a license for Edius X. Once you have a valid license, the watermark will be removed from your output videos. You can buy a license from the official Grass Valley website or from authorized resellers.
  2. Use a third-party tool: There are some third-party tools and plugins available that can remove the Edius X watermark. These tools work by analyzing the video frame and removing the watermark. However, be cautious when using third-party tools, as they may not always work effectively and can potentially harm your video quality.
  3. Manual removal: Advanced video editors can try to manually remove the watermark using video editing software. This involves using tools like the clone brush or the healing tool to remove the watermark frame by frame. However, this method can be time-consuming and requires advanced video editing skills.
